#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<unistd.h>
#include <arpa/inet.h>
#define PORT 8081
#define BUFFER_SIZE 1024
int main() {
int server_fd, new_socket;
struct sockaddr_in address;
int addrlen = sizeof(address);
// Creating socket file descriptor
if ((server_fd = socket(AF_INET, SOCK_STREAM, 0)) == 0) {
perror("socket failed");
exit(EXIT_FAILURE);
}
// Forcefully attaching socket to the port 8080
address.sin_family = AF_INET;
address.sin_addr.s_addr = INADDR_ANY;
address.sin_port = htons(PORT);
// Binding the socket to the address
if (bind(server_fd, (struct sockaddr *)&address, sizeof(address)) < 0) {
perror("bind failed");
exit(EXIT_FAILURE);
}
// Start listening for incoming connections
if (listen(server_fd, 3) < 0) {
perror("listen");
exit(EXIT_FAILURE);
}
printf("Server is listening on port %d...\n", PORT);
while (1) {
printf("Waiting for a connection...\n");
// Accept a new connection
if ((new_socket = accept(server_fd, (struct sockaddr *)&address, (socklen_t*)&addrlen)) < 0) {
perror("accept");
exit(EXIT_FAILURE);
}
// Read the HTTP request
char buffer[BUFFER_SIZE] = {0};
read(new_socket, buffer, BUFFER_SIZE);
printf("Received request:\n%s\n", buffer);
// Simple HTTP response
char *response = "HTTP/1.1 200 OK\r\n"
"Content-Type: text/html\r\n"
"Content-Length: 47\r\n"
"\r\n"
"<html><body><h1>Hello, World!</h1></body></html>";
// Send the HTTP response
write(new_socket, response, strlen(response));
printf("Response sent\n");
// Close the connection
close(new_socket);
}
return 0;
}
